Interested in College Tennis? Let Us Help You!
Thinking about college tennis, but don’t know where to start? Well, USTA Mid-Atlantic is all about connecting you with collegiate coaches from programs in the Section and beyond to help with your college tennis journey. Use the resources available here and players should fill out the player Interest form which will facilitate connections for players and coaches.
Benefits of Completing a Player Profile
By filling out a player profile, it allows the college coaches who have expressed interest in connecting with Mid-Atlantic players (listed below). By completing this step you will build awareness with college tennis coaches so you can find your fit with your ideal program.
To find the best fit in college, it is important to understand what coaches are looking for. ADVERTISEMENT When you complete the profile you will also receive information about the schools and what they are looking for in a recruit. This form is recommended for current Juniors and Seniors Only.
